How are months calculated?

We add 980 calendar months to today's date using proper calendar arithmetic. If the resulting date would overflow (e.g. January 31 + 1 month), it is clamped to the last valid day of the target month.

Did You Know?

The names of the months have Roman origins. January honors Janus (god of beginnings), March honors Mars (god of war), and July and August were renamed for Julius Caesar and Emperor Augustus. September through December come from Latin numbers (7 through 10), which made sense when the Roman calendar started in March - Making them the 7th through 10th months.
